The legendary Awilo Longomba to grace Eddy Kenzo’s show this Friday

According to a video making rounds on Instagram, the legendary Congolese music superstar Awilo Longomba not only endorsed Eddy Kenzo’s January 4 show dubbed 10 Years of Eddy Kenzo but he also confirmed that he will be in attendance to witness history being made in a video making rounds on Instagram.

Growing up, many of us danced to the tunes and rhymes of Awilo Longomba the waste shaking sensational musician whose music made us get off our seats will be with us come January 4 at the Kampala Serena Hotel.

Awilo Longomba is a Congolese musician who was a drummer in Viva la Musica, Stukas, Nouvelle Generation and Loketo. In 1995, he finally quit drumming for singing and released his first album Moto Pamba with help from Shimita, Ballou Canta, Dindo Yogo, Dally Kimoko, Sam Mangwana, Syran Mbenza and Rigo Star.

The January 4 musical concert is slated to celebrate Kenzo’s 10 years of musical success and to share it with fans.

Tickets are on sale at Shs. 100,000 for Ordinary, Shs. 300,000 for VIP, and Shs 3m for a table. You can get your ticket(s) at Serena Hotel, Airtel shop at Game mall, Airtel Shop at Thobani mall, and Airtel shop at Shoprite Ben Kiwanuka Street.
